4. But actually we don't know that OBL has kidney disease or was on dialysis. Remember, reportedly he
also was in cahoots with Saddam too.

Snopes: http://www.snopes.com/rumors/kidney.htm

And from Lawrence Wright, author of "The Looming Tower"...

"In Saudi Arabia Wright started filling in the details of bin Laden's life, a portrait at odds with the urban myths put out by the CIA.

"If you could take your mind back to the kinds of things that we thought we knew about bin Laden back then, that he was, you know, a billionaire as the CIA said, that he was a physical giant, that he had kidney disease, none of those things is true," Wright said. "I talked to everybody who knew him..." http://www.cbsnews.com/stories/2007/09/09/sunday/main3244713.shtml
